about summary refs log tree commit diff
path: root/config/locales
diff options
context:
space:
mode:
Diffstat (limited to 'config/locales')
-rw-r--r--config/locales/activerecord.ru.yml12
-rw-r--r--config/locales/simple_form.ru.yml15
2 files changed, 25 insertions, 2 deletions
diff --git a/config/locales/activerecord.ru.yml b/config/locales/activerecord.ru.yml
new file mode 100644
index 000000000..316637888
--- /dev/null
+++ b/config/locales/activerecord.ru.yml
@@ -0,0 +1,12 @@
+ru:
+  activerecord:
+    errors:
+      models:
+        account:
+          attributes:
+            username:
+              invalid: только буквы, цифры и символ подеркивания
+        status:
+          attributes:
+            reblog:
+              taken: статуса уже существует
diff --git a/config/locales/simple_form.ru.yml b/config/locales/simple_form.ru.yml
index b5e7eee67..a91672970 100644
--- a/config/locales/simple_form.ru.yml
+++ b/config/locales/simple_form.ru.yml
@@ -4,14 +4,24 @@ ru:
     hints:
       defaults:
         avatar: PNG, GIF или JPG. Максимально 2MB. Будет уменьшено до 120x120px
-        display_name: 'Осталось символов: <span class="name-counter">%{count}</span>'
+        display_name:
+          one: 'Остался <span class="name-counter">1</span> символ'
+          few: 'Осталось <span class="name-counter">%{count}</span> символа'
+          many: 'Осталось <span class="name-counter">%{count}</span> символов'
+          other: 'Осталось <span class="name-counter">%{count}</span> символов'
         header: PNG, GIF или JPG. Максимально 2MB. Будет уменьшено до 700x335px
         locked: Потребует от Вас ручного подтверждения подписчиков, изменит приватность постов по умолчанию на "только для подписчиков"
-        note: 'Осталось символов: <span class="note-counter">%{count}</span>'
+        note:
+          one: 'Остался <span class="name-counter">1</span> символ'
+          few: 'Осталось <span class="name-counter">%{count}</span> символа'
+          many: 'Осталось <span class="name-counter">%{count}</span> символов'
+          other: 'Осталось <span class="name-counter">%{count}</span> символов'
       imports:
         data: Файл CSV, экспортированный с другого узла Mastodon
       sessions:
         otp: Введите код двухфакторной аутентификации или используйте один из Ваших кодов восстановления.
+      user:
+        filtered_languages: Выбранные языки будут убраны из Ваших публичных лет.
     labels:
       defaults:
         avatar: Аватар
@@ -21,6 +31,7 @@ ru:
         data: Данные
         display_name: Показываемое имя
         email: Адрес e-mail
+        filtered_languages: Фильтруемые языки
         header: Заголовок
         locale: Язык
         locked: Сделать аккаунт приватным